CVE-2023-0810 is a stored Cross-site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ability affecting BTCPay Server versions prior to 1.7.11. This medium-severity flaw (CVSS 5.4) allows an authenticated attacker to inject malicious scripts into the application, which could then execute in other users' browsers, potentially leading to information disclosure or limited integrity impact. While no public exploits or active exploitation have been observed, and community discussion is minimal, the vulnerability remains a risk for unpatched instances.
